"Scenes from Russian Folk Life" is an engraving by Ignatii Stepanovich Shchedrovskii, a Russian artist born in 1815 and who died in 1870. This artwork, now in the Art Institute of Chicago, depicts a scene from everyday life in Russia, showcasing four figures in traditional dress. The composition, featuring a young boy, an elderly man, and two other figures, captures a moment of interaction, perhaps at a marketplace or harbor. The artist, known for his realistic portrayals, skillfully utilizes light and shadow to highlight details and add depth to the figures. This artwork provides a glimpse into the rich cultural heritage of Russia.
